20kW commercial solar — cost, ROI & payback

Last updated 27 July 2026

A 20kW commercial solar system typically costs about £21,000 to install in 2026 (ex-VAT), within a usual range of roughly £19,000 to £24,000 depending on your roof, kit and access.1 It needs around 140 m² of unshaded south-facing roof and generates about 19,000 kWh a year. For a typical daytime business self-consuming most of that power, the estimated annual saving is around £4,300, giving a simple payback of roughly 5 years before any tax relief. These are estimates for a typical site — your figures depend on your load, roof and tariff.

What a 20kW commercial solar system costs in 2026

At the 20kW scale, UK installed prices in 2026 sit at roughly £1,000 to £1,200 per kWp (ex-VAT) for a straightforward rooftop job, which puts a full system around £21,000, or between about £19,000 and £24,000.1 Per-kWp cost falls as systems get bigger, so a 20kW install is more expensive per unit than a 100kW+ scheme but cheaper than a small 10kW one. The figures below are an estimate for a typical single-phase or small three-phase rooftop site; a survey will confirm yours.

ComponentTypical shareEstimated cost (ex-VAT)
Panels / modules (~36–40 panels)30%£6,300
Inverter(s)12%£2,500
Mounting & roof fixings10%£2,100
Cabling, isolators & electrical works12%£2,500
Installation labour19%£4,000
Scaffolding / access8%£1,600
Design, DNO (G99) application, MCS & commissioning9%£2,000
Total installed (ex-VAT)100%£21,000
Illustrative breakdown for a typical 20kW rooftop site, 2026; ranges vary by installer and roof — source: PlutoHome analysis of 2026 UK commercial installer pricing.1
Battery is optional. Storage is not included above and typically adds £400–£600 per usable kWh.1 A daytime business that already uses most of its generation on-site often does not need one to make the numbers work.

How much a 20kW system generates

A well-sited UK system yields roughly 950 kWh per kWp per year, so 20kWp produces about 19,000 kWh annually — enough to make a real dent in a mid-sized commercial bill.2 Output depends on orientation, pitch and shading; a survey uses your postcode and roof to model it precisely.

  • Roof area needed: about 7 m² per kWp, so roughly 140 m² for 20kW.
  • Annual generation: ~19,000 kWh (an estimate for a typical site).2
  • Panel count: around 36–40 modern panels at ~500–550 W each.
  • Degradation: modern panels lose roughly 0.5% output a year, so a 25-year system still generates around 88% of its year-one figure in its final year.6

Savings, payback and 25-year ROI

The saving comes from two things: the grid electricity you no longer buy (worth most), and a small payment for surplus you export. A typical daytime commercial site — offices, workshops, retail, light industrial — self-consumes around 60–85% of what it generates; we model 70% here. We value avoided grid power at about 26p/kWh, in line with average non-domestic prices,3 and exported units at a 15p/kWh Smart Export Guarantee rate.4

ItemAmountEstimated value / year
Annual generation19,000 kWh
Self-consumed (70%) @ 26p/kWh13,300 kWh£3,458
Exported (30%) @ 15p/kWh (SEG)5,700 kWh£855
Estimated total annual saving19,000 kWh~£4,300
Estimate for a typical site; your figures depend on your load profile, self-consumption, tariff and SEG rate. Electricity price: DESNZ Quarterly Energy Prices.3

On a £21,000 outlay and a ~£4,300 annual saving, simple payback is around 5 years before tax relief. Because the saving is dominated by avoided grid cost, a higher electricity tariff or higher self-consumption shortens payback; a lower one lengthens it.

Over a 25-year life, if prices simply held flat the system would save on the order of £95,000–£100,000 — an illustration, not a promise, since real electricity prices and your usage will differ. Allowing for panel degradation and one likely inverter replacement (~£2,500), that points to an estimated lifetime net benefit near £75,000 after the original cost. VAT and the 50% first-year allowance

Two tax points materially affect the real cost — confirm both with your own accountant.

  • VAT: the 0% VAT rate applies to domestic solar only. Commercial solar pays 20% VAT, but a VAT-registered business normally reclaims it, so the net cost usually returns to the ex-VAT figure.5
  • Capital allowances: solar PV is classed as special-rate plant. That means it does not qualify for 100% full expensing (which is for main-rate plant), but special-rate assets qualify for the 50% first-year allowance, made permanent from April 2023.6 Separately, most businesses can instead use the Annual Investment Allowance (100% up to £1m a year), which comfortably covers a £21,000 system — so many buyers write the full cost off in year one.7
Worked illustration. If a company uses the AIA to deduct the full £21,000 and pays 25% corporation tax, that is roughly £5,250 of tax saved in year one — trimming payback toward about 4 years. This is a general illustration, not tax advice; your relief depends on your profits, allowances and how you fund the system.

Which premises a 20kW system typically suits

A 20kW system suits businesses that use meaningful power through the working day and have around 140 m² of usable roof. As a rough guide, it fits sites with an annual electricity bill of roughly £5,000–£12,000 and steady daytime demand, where most generation is used on-site rather than exported.

Commercial solar — your questions

How much does a 20kW commercial solar system cost in 2026?

About £21,000 installed (ex-VAT) for a typical rooftop site, within a usual range of roughly £19,000 to £24,000 depending on roof type, kit and access. Commercial solar pays 20% VAT, which a VAT-registered business normally reclaims. This is an estimate; a survey confirms your figure.

How much electricity does a 20kW system generate?

Around 19,000 kWh a year in the UK, based on a typical yield of about 950 kWh per kWp. Actual output depends on orientation, pitch, location and shading. It needs roughly 140 m² of usable roof.

What is the payback on a 20kW commercial solar system?

Roughly 5 years before tax relief, based on an estimated annual saving near £4,300 against a £21,000 cost. Using the Annual Investment Allowance and corporation tax relief can shorten that toward about 4 years. Your payback depends on your load, self-consumption and electricity tariff.

Does commercial solar get 0% VAT?

No. The 0% VAT rate applies to domestic solar only. Commercial solar is charged at 20% VAT, but a VAT-registered business can normally reclaim it, so the effective cost usually returns to the ex-VAT price. Confirm with your accountant.

Can a business claim the 50% first-year allowance on solar?

Solar PV is special-rate plant, so it qualifies for the permanent 50% first-year allowance rather than 100% full expensing, which is for main-rate plant. Many businesses instead use the Annual Investment Allowance (100% up to £1m), which covers a 20kW system in full. Verify with your accountant.

How much roof do I need for 20kW of solar?

About 140 m², based on roughly 7 m² per kWp, using around 36 to 40 modern panels. Pitched and flat roofs differ; a survey confirms the usable area and layout for your building.

What size business does a 20kW system suit?

Typically sites with an annual electricity bill of around £5,000 to £12,000 and steady daytime demand — small warehouses, workshops, farm buildings, shops and schools. Larger loads usually benefit from 30kW to 100kW systems, which cost less per kWp.
